overall I thought it was a good company to work for

Retail Wireless Consultant (Former Employee)
Chicago, IL

I worked at U.S. Cellular full-time for more than 3 years

ProsAs a Retail Wireless Consultant there is a good training program. The good Sales Managers that I had had did a good job helping me along, and I never felt like there was a manager that I couldnt talk to. Even though it's a retail schedule the work/life balance is very good, I never worked more than 40 hours/week (unless I requested to over holidays), and there's never any work to take home with you

ConsSold Chicago market to Sprint and closed the stores in Chicago. I never felt like there were a lot of opportunities to move up in the organization if I did not want to become a Sales Manager or work at a call center.

Advice to Senior ManagementThere has been a lot of change at U.S. Cellular over the time that I've been there and some of it has been difficult, make sure to keep communication open and honest like I feel like you do

Was, at one time, the best company I've worked for.

Retail Wireless Consultant (Former Employee)
Midwest City, OK

I worked at U.S. Cellular full-time for more than 3 years

ProsBest call quality in their markets, extremely customer focused, used to have excellent employee/employer relationships, used to have an above standard commission structure, used to have excellent employee recognition.

ConsCommission was cut in half, micro managed every employee, increased duties of sales consultants without increasing pay. In fact, they took commission away. Promotions were given to less qualified individuals.

Advice to Senior ManagementTry understanding that without sales people, there would be no increased customer base. If you're going to cut pay, take it from the people who make 6 figures instead of people who work mostly on commission. Before implementing policies and regulations, try asking the employees who deal with customers on a daily basis how the new regulations or policies might impact them or customers.
